Latest Patents

Seung-yong Oh's latest patents include a conveyor apparatus and a method of correcting the position of a prober. The conveyor apparatus features a rail formed in a closed curve line, a chain conveyor that moves along the rail, and a driver that operates the chain conveyor. Additionally, it includes first and second variable conveyors that adjust the lengths of at least two portions of the chain conveyor, allowing a section to remain stationary while other portions move along the rail. The method of correcting a position of a prober involves obtaining images of a pad with a predetermined reference contact position, determining the actual contact position after contacting the prober, and correcting the prober's position based on offset data derived from the comparison of the images.
